Overview Of Costs
Typical cost ranges for a furnace replacement including installation in the United States generally fall between 3500 and 9000 dollars, with lower prices for basic 80 AFUE models and higher prices for high efficiency 95 AFUE or 97 AFUE systems. When a heat pump or dual fuel setup is used, the price can exceed 10000 dollars. For budgeting, consider both the furnace unit price and the installation cost as separate line items. Factors That Affect Price
Efficiency and capacity drive major costs. An 80 AFUE furnace is typically cheaper than a 95 AFUE or 97 AFUE model. Another driver is the furnace size in BTU or tons, which must match home heating load. In addition, ductwork condition and whether new vents or zoning add to the bill can shift price. Regional labor rates also influence total.
What Drives Price
Key drivers include the furnace’s AFUE rating, installed capacity, and whether a contractor must upgrade or replace ducts. Installation complexity, gas line work, and venting changes add to labor time. If a home requires a new condensate line or thermostat integration, costs rise. Seasonal demand can also push prices higher in peak winter months.

Regional Price Differences
Prices vary by region due to labor markets and local code requirements. In the Northeast urban areas, expect higher installation charges, while suburban zones may offer mid range pricing. Rural areas often have lower labor costs but may incur travel fees and longer lead times. Across regions, total costs typically shift by about ±15 to 25 percent depending on the job scope.
Labor & Installation Time
Most residential furnace replacements take 1 to 2 days, depending on ductwork and venting needs. A straightforward job with existing ductwork may run 8 to 12 hours of labor, while projects requiring custom duct redesign or gas line upgrades can exceed 16 hours. Labor costs are usually the largest single expense.
Additional & Hidden Costs
Hidden items can include refrigerant or refrigerant disposal for heat pump setups, extended duct sealing, or extra outdoor venting. Some contractors charge for trip fees or after hours scheduling. If the home lacks proper vent clearance or needs attic access improvements, expect extra charges. Always verify whether taxes are included in the quote or billed separately.
Real World Pricing Examples
Basic scenario includes a standard 80 AFUE gas furnace, standard ductwork, and local permit. Units and labor total around 3,500 dollars with a few add ons.
Mid range includes a 95 AFUE unit, modest duct upgrades, and a typical thermostat integration. Total near 6,000 dollars with installation and disposal.
Premium scenario uses a 97 AFUE or gas electric hybrid, full duct reseal, and extended warranty. Project can reach 9,000 to 12,000 dollars depending on home size and routing.
